Reinforcement learning for swarm robotics: An overview of applications, algorithms and simulators

[Display omitted] Robots such as drones, ground rovers, underwater vehicles and industrial robots have increased in popularity in recent years. Many sectors have benefited from this by increasing productivity while also decreasing costs and certain risks to humans. These robots can be controlled ind...

Full description

Saved in:
Bibliographic Details
Published inCognitive robotics Vol. 3; pp. 226 - 256
Main Authors Blais, Marc-Andrė, Akhloufi, Moulay A.
Format Journal Article
LanguageEnglish
Published Elsevier B.V 2023
KeAi Communications Co. Ltd
Subjects
Online AccessGet full text
ISSN2667-2413
2667-2413
DOI10.1016/j.cogr.2023.07.004

Cover

More Information
Summary:[Display omitted] Robots such as drones, ground rovers, underwater vehicles and industrial robots have increased in popularity in recent years. Many sectors have benefited from this by increasing productivity while also decreasing costs and certain risks to humans. These robots can be controlled individually but are more efficient in a large group, also known as a swarm. However, an increase in the quantity and complexity of robots creates the need for an adequate control system. Reinforcement learning, an artificial intelligence paradigm, is an increasingly popular approach to control a swarm of unmanned vehicles. The quantity of reviews in the field of reinforcement learning-based swarm robotics is limited. We propose reviewing the various applications, algorithms and simulators on the subject to fill this gap. First, we present the current applications on swarm robotics with a focus on reinforcement learning control systems. Subsequently, we define important reinforcement learning terminologies, followed by a review of the current state-of-the-art in the field of swarm robotics utilizing reinforcement learning. Additionally, we review the various simulators used to train, validate and simulate swarms of unmanned vehicles. We finalize our review by discussing our findings and the possible directions for future research. Overall, our review demonstrates the potential and state-of-the-art reinforcement learning-based control systems for swarm robotics.
ISSN:2667-2413
2667-2413
DOI:10.1016/j.cogr.2023.07.004